Уважаемые владельцы КПК и КМК с WM6.5, прочитайте нижеследующие цитаты:
Для владельцев КПК
-Василь Иваныч, вот <acronym title='КПК - это Карманный Персональный Компьютер - БЕЗ ТЕЛЕФОННОГО МОДУЛЯ!'>КПК</acronym> себе купил -Круто, Петька! -Та не в этом дело, Василь Иваныч, ставлю эмулятор явы, а он не пашет, а ведь на коммуникаторе все работало... -Акстись, Петька, Библиотеки sms.dll и phone.dll ставил? -Нет Василь Иваныч, а что это? -Это, Петька... Библиотеки для запуска эмулей на КПК. -Ааа...
-Василь Иваныч, я вот <acronym title='КМК - это КоМмуниКатор = КПК + телефонный модуль'>КМК</acronym> с WM6.5 себе купил -Круто, Петька! -Да не в этом дело, Василь Иваныч, ставлю эмулятор явы, а пароль не могу ввести нигде, а ведь на коммуникаторе с WM6.0 и 6.1 все работало... -Акстись, Петька, Библиотеку compime.dll ставил? -Нет Василь Иваныч, а что это? -Это, Петька... Библиотека исправленная для ввода паролей на wm6.5. -Ааа... -Не забудь перезагрузиться, Петька.
QVGA: - tigerSW.cn Jbed OpenGL 2.3.1013.1>> (поддержка видеоускорителя, создаёт ярлыки, эмулирует несколько разрешений экрана) >>>> + rus mui>> \Program Files\Myriad - tigerSW.cn Jbed OpenGL Mod by Relay (что за зверь, не знаю) >> - Myriad Group JBed 20090506.2.1 12M (heap 12Mb, 3gp) >> - Myriad Group JBed 20090506.2.1 8M (heap 8Mb, 3gp) >> - Esmertec JBed 2009.05.06.2.1 (heap 12 Mb, без залипания) >> - Esmertec JBed 2009.05.06.2.1>> (heap 8Mb, JSR-184 (3D), 3gp, mp3, mid, amr, JSR-75 (но OM5 не открыла основную память), <acronym title='выделение всего текста в окне полноэкранного редактирования'>выделение текста</acronym>, <acronym title='OMmod работает, но долго грузится при включении'>OMmod</acronym>, <acronym title='запросы безопасности только один раз'>без запросов</acronym>) + exe без залипания>> \Program Files\JBed_2009.05.06_2.1\jbed.exe; \Program Files\JBed_2009.05.06_2.1\appdb; HKLM\software\esmertec\090506210\device info\java font - Esmertec JBed 2009.04.16.5.1 8M>> (heap 8Mb, JSR-184 (3D), 3gp, mp3, wav, mid, JSR-75 (фс), <acronym title='выделение только одного слова в окне полноэкранного редактирования текста'>выделение слова</acronym>, <acronym title='виснет при выходе из полноэкранного редактирования'>OM5</acronym>, OMmod, <acronym title='без запросов безопасности'>без запросов</acronym>) + exe без залипания>> \windows\jbed.exe; \Program Files\esmertec\appdb; HKLM\software\Apps\Esmertec Java\Device Info\Java Font - Esmertec JBed 2009.02.16.5.1 (3D и heap 12Mb) >> - Esmertec JBed 2009.02.17.5.1R2>> (heap 4Mb, JSR-184 (3D), 3gp, mp3, wav, mid, JSR-75 (фс), <acronym title='выделение только одного слова в окне полноэкранного редактирования текста'>выделение слова</acronym>, <acronym title='виснет при выходе из полноэкранного редактирования'>OM5</acronym>, OMmod) + замена файлов: без залипания и запросов \windows\jbed.exe; \Windows\Appdb; \HKLM\Software\Apps\Esmertec Java\Device Info\Java Font; (после замены файлов: \HKLM\Software\Esmertec\090216_51\Properties\Device Info\Java Font]) - Esmertec Jbed 2009.02.17.5.1R2 Rus>> - Esmertec JBed 20081203.2.1 (многозадачность, отсутствует 3d, создаёт ярлыки!) >>: • JBed 2008.12.03.2.1_WinDir_En - установка в папку "Windows", для eng версии, т.е.у кого "Start Menu". • JBed 2008.12.03.2.1_WinDir_Ru - установка в папку "Windows", для rus версии, т.е. у кого "Главное Меню". (heap 8Mb|16Mb>>) • JBed 2008.12.03.2.1 - можно устанавливать везде, но ярлыки будет создаваться неправильно. - Esmertec Jbed 20081203.2.1 (корректно работающий с карты памяти) >> Все вопросы и претензии к The_ZeN - Esmertec JBed 2008.09.12.5.1 by Sorg (нет залипаний, разлочены все медиа форматы, нет запросов, heap 8Mb) >> - Esmertec JBed 2008.09.12.5.1 by padona4ek (не модифицирована в отличии от by Sorg, работает на всех экранах) - Esmertec JBed 2008.03.28.3.1 (3D, heap 12Mb, без запросов, Rus/Eng, на прошивках 6.5.x внизу не "проваливается" за экран) >> - Esmertec JBed 2008.03.28.3.1 VolROM +8mb (heap 8Mb, Rus/Eng) >>>> - Esmertec JBed 2008.03.28.3.1 RUS (heap 4Mb, Rus) >> - Esmertec JBedModHeapFix(02.01.08) >> - Esmertec JBed3dModHeapFix(02.01.08) >>>> (играет звуки своеобразно: копирует файлы в временную папку (по умолчанию - \Application Data\Volatile\), проигрывает и потом, по идее, удаляет. По идее потому, что midi и wav он удаляет корректно, а mp3 оставляет.) - Esmertec JBed3dMod HeapSizeFix 12.02.2008 на основе Esmertec Jbed ver.20071119.3.1 >> (без запросов) - EsmertecJbedNotForStorage(02.01.08 ??) >> - Jbedtestgiris (23.02.08 byDom1nat0R aka NermaN) - JBed3dMod RU Fix 1.1 на основе тестовой версии JBed3dMod_HeapSizeFix_17.02.08 (Esmertec Jbed v.20071119.3.1) >>>> (перезагрузить устройство после установки).
- JBed3dMod_HeapSizeFix (25.02.08) >> - Работает как с карты, так и с основной памяти. Инсталлируется в "%Program Files%/Jbed3DMod". Можно увеличить шрифт: 1. Удалить %Program Files%/Jbed3DMod/jbe0524.dll. 2. Вместо неё из папки %Program Files%/Jbed3DMod/Dll скопировать новую: чем больше плюсиков в названии dll, тем крупнее шрифт в ней "содержится". 2. Переименовать ее в jbe0524.dll Кто хочет английский язык, удаляйте "jbed.exe.0409.mui", а "jbed.exe.0409_Eng.mui" переименуйте в "jbed.exe.0409.mui".
Примечание: Если вы ставите эмуляторы на КПК(т.е у вас отсутствует телефонный модуль), то вам будут необходимы библиотеки phone.dll и sms.dll. На форуме присутствуют библиотеки только для wm5(см. шапку). Их работоспособность на wm2003 не проверена. Кто проверит просьба отписаться о результатах. Также необходимо, чтобы девайс был разлочен.
Порядок запуска мидлетов эмулятором Esmertec Java:
1. Устанавливаем ява-эмулятор; 2. Теперь все jar и jad файлы ассоциированы с эмулятором -> можно открыть их из любого файл-менеджера и начнётся установка; или открыть эмулятор и инициировать в нём поиск java файлов. Найти нужный и начать установку; 3. После нескольких вопрос java установтся; 4. Запускать java-программы из эмулятора. Более подробно в сообщении volta_john № 398636
Можно создать ярлык на каждую установленную java-программу:
5.1 Создаем txt-файл с текстом: 28#"\Windows\jbed.exe" -run s№_ № - порядковый номер мидлетов, начинается от 0. № смотреть в директория_с_эмулятором\appdb\selector.utf в секциях root=s№_, \ Путь до jbed.exe может быть разным в зависимости от версии эмулятора:
Так что зайдите в \windows\главное меню\программы. Откройте любым текстовым редактором файл jbed.lnk и скопируйте из него путь.
• Так же есть возможость поставить иконку на ярлык: 28#"\Windows\jbed.exe" -run s№_?Icon.dll,-7 Если просто написать Icon.dll, то эта библиотека должна находиться в папке Windows. Либо можно прописать полный адрес к библиотеке с иконками в ярлыке. После Icon.dll,- указывается номер иконки в библиотеке. Полный пример ярлыка с иконкой:
- Эмулятор при запуске образует менеджер мидлетов под именем "Midlet HQ". - Все установившиеся мидлеты он пишет в My Documents/temp. - После удаления какого-либо мидлета из "Midlet HQ", может потребоваться его ручное удаление из My Documents/temp. - Эмулятор работает на Storage card - Jad-файл при установке мидлетов не требуется - Работает с буфером обмена - Если при запуске эмулятора мало свободной RAM памяти, он может не запуститься, при этом никаких сообщений не выводится - Стандартный комплект IBM J9 WEME MIDP20 JMM не поддерживает спецификацию JSR75 - у мидлетов нет доступа к файловой системе КПК. Этот патч устранит проблему. После установки патча перенастраиваем разрешения модифицированной Opera mini в MIDlet HQ - Actions -> Permissions: Comm, File Read и File Write нужно установить в Always allowed (настройки предоставлены volta_john). - Способ ликвидации запросов security эмулятора IBM J9, в том числе о разрешении доступа в сеть (если Вас это беспокоит), выложил Yago De Malina в сообщении № 886752. - ненравится шрифт в v. 6.1.0 для QVGA - Замена шрифта пост № 324711 - Альтернативый способ Vadya corp. № 468394 - IBM иногда глючит - слетают все установленные в него мидлеты или закладки в Опере мини, Опера мини загружает белые листы, а потом вообще перестает запускаться и т.п. Лечения см. в сообщении № 472209
Можно создать ярлык на каждую установленную java-программу:
1. Создаем txt-файл с текстом: 77#"\Storage card\IBM MIDP20\bin\emulator.exe" "-Xjam:run=№" (спасибо Isidor) № - порядковый номер мидлета в списке установленных мидлетов. Путь до emulator.exe нужно вписать свой. 2. Сохраняем в txt; 3. Меняем расширение файла на lnk; 4. Перемещаем файл в \windows\главное меню\программы.
Запуск мидлетов можно производить при помощи ярлыков:
- Ярлык для запуска мидлета выглядит так: 77#"\Storage card\IBM MIDP20\bin\emulator.exe" "-Xdescriptor:\Storage card\Opera mini\opera117.jar" (спасибо Konrad и VitAR). - Пути, естественно, ваши. - Данный способ можно использовать для запуска любых мидлетов, изменяя при этом только пути к файлам. - При запуске мидлета через указанный ярлык он временно устанавливается в эмулятор, а при окончании работы - дезинсталлируется. Поэтому история и закладки в Opera mini при таком методе запуска не сохраняются. (ярлычки от konrad)
Для работы данного эмулятора на любых девайсах были разработаны патчи elate.dll (для версий 10.1.2.57, 10.1.2.76 и 11.1.7.1023 их разработал ZuRiUs, а для версии 11.1.7.1034 - dFine1107). Ниже преведенные Cаb'ы уже пропатчены.
dFine1107 добавил также возможность установки в любое место и возможность деинсталляции штатными средствами. - TAO v. 10.1.2.76 (WM 2003/WM5) - ТАО v. 11.1.7.1034 для коммуникаторов (WM5/WM6) - ТАО v. 11.1.7.1023 (Build 20060907) НЕ для коммуникаторов – (WM5/WM6/не пропатчен/не мод.)
- Jad-файл при установке мидлетов не требуется - С буфером обмена эмулятор в штатном режиме не работает. Патч для работы буфером обмена смотреть тут - 11-е версии эмулятора имеют доступ к файловой системе КПК - TAO больше подходит для java-игр, чем для работы с сетевыми мидлетами. - На TAO периодически возникает такая проблема - при установке или удалении очередного мидлета процесс как-бы зависает и внезапно заканчивается тем, что пользовательский интерфейс эмулятора вдруг оказывается пустым. Лечение см. в сообщении № 472209
Java-эмуляторы с поддержкой Bluetooth (JSR-82) теперь существуют! :) (их истоки >>)
Если в приложениях нет звука сначала прочтите этот пост
broTHEr_LIS, просто этот эмуль похоже для смартов... так как он тестировался на НТС S710... а это смарт!!! На кпк он пока ни у кого не запустился (по крайней мере об этом никто не сообщал)!
Случайно наткнулся на версию эмулятора IBM J9 v6.1.1 от 09.11.2006 Поддерживаются вибрация и WM5 софт-клавиши без тап зон, как было в предыдущей версии. Звук проверял - не работает :( Может у вас получится, пробуйте.
Вот у меня проблема: скачал ТАО 11 из шапки, запустил, работает, но НЕВОЗМОЖНО нажать две клавиши, которые у обычного телефона находятся под экраном, а большая часть 3D не пойдёт без этого. КПК Acer n311. Кто знает как ркшить помогите, с меня +1, естевственно.
В IRC-клиенте Inettools последней версии, запущенном с помощью IBM 6.1.1, хорошо слышны WAV-звуки оповещений. При копировании этих звуков внутрь Jimm - тишина. Выходит дело не только в эмуле, но и в спецификации ява-приложения.
theOFFSPRING, Может быть Вы уже прочитали - я только что писал в соседней теме, что сигнал оповещения в Jimm работает, если в настройках выставить "Гудок". Добиться от него большего мне не удалось.
rendor, Гудок в Jimm работает с незапамятных времен со всевозможными эмуляторами. Я бы даже назвал его аналогией встроенной в материнскую плату компьютера пищалки. Вся суть как раз-таки заключается в правильном воспроизведении звуков, проходящих через звуковую карту устройства.
Сообщение отредактировал theOFFSPRING - 19.09.07, 00:55
можно вместо т9 использовать просто быстрый перебор букв по телефонной хард-клаве, я использую GStupidInput, самая быстрая прога и отлично работает в Тао. смс не набить, но в модах мини оперы или в играх навигация очень удобна и совершенно не тормозит. Тема по проге есть на форуме.
daemonpnz, для скорости переписки особо по экрану не пощелкаешь. Я себе коммуникатор покупал для аськи и основным критерием являлось наличие цифровой хард-клавы (чтобы не переучиваться после симбиановских смартов). К тому же зима на носу, замерзшие пальцы, толстые перчатки, то есть все, что делает использование всевозможных экранных клавиатур и методов ввода малоэффективным.
PerAspera, я пробовал GStupid Input, отличный метод ввода, не спорю, но опять же в скорости он не сравним с т9.
daemonpnz, Я уже ее пробовал. Спасибо за предложение. Я все объяснил в предыдущем посте. Мы ушли от темы. Суть заключается в том, чтобы понять, почему в эмуляторе IBM в одних приложениях работает wav-звук, причем громко и отчетливо, а в других - нет.